Luka Doncic and the LA Lakers had a bit of fun with their extra time off. On Instagram, the team showed how Doncic had a friendly competition with coach JJ Redick. The Slovenian sensation challenged the former NBA player in a game of half-court shots. However, given that the star guard has more reps shooting it from such a distance, it ended up being one-sided.

Doncic and Redick each had two attempts at first. The five-time All-Star made both shots, while the coach struggled. The former Duke star was ready to move on, but the Lakers star insisted that they keep going. On their third attempt, they both missed.

On the fourth try, Redick missed the shot. Doncic, meanwhile, was feeling a bit confident and told his teammate, Deandre Ayton, that the ball won't touch the rim. He then nailed the shot perfectly, only touching the net. Ayton was taken aback by how good the 6-foot-6 star was.

“He just called that?” Ayton said. “Looked me dead in my eye and said that?”

JJ Redick talks about the Lakers' late-game mistake with Luka Doncic and LeBron James

During the game between the LA Lakers and Phoenix Suns on Sunday, LeBron James drew a technical foul from Dillon Brooks. After the officials called it, the Lakers had time to discuss strategy. However, James surprised everyone when he shot the technical free throw, which he missed.

Following the game, JJ Redick revealed that it was supposed to be Luka Doncic who should've shot the free throws. At that time, the Suns had a one-point lead, 114-113, and making the technical free throw was important.

“Guys were out on the court,” Redick said. “Luka and I talked. I thought Luka was going to shoot it. I walked back. LeBron was at the free throw line and he shot it. I don’t know what the dialogue on the court was. We did this at some point last year. “Early in the season, we designated ‘Here’s who going to shoot the technicals.’ Every team is different. Sometimes its the superstar, sometimes it’s the best free throw shooter, sometimes it’s the guy who maybe needs to see the ball go in the basket. It’s all situational. But Luka should have shot that.”

Fortunately for Luka Doncic and the Lakers, James made up for it when he drew a foul on his 3-point attempt. He knocked down two shots and gave the team a 116-114 win.
